Analysis

Kazakhstan recorded 4.0% for coverage in extreme poor (<$2.15 a day) (%) - all social assistance in 2021. That is the lowest value across all 9 years on record.

Compared with earlier readings it is down 91.7% on the previous year and down 94.0% over ten years.

Over the whole period, coverage in extreme poor (<$2.15 a day) (%) - all social assistance in Kazakhstan peaked at 81.4% in 2015 and was at its lowest, 4.0%, in 2021.

Kazakhstan ranks 33rd of 38 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.

Coverage in extreme poor (<$2.15 a day) (%) - All Social Assistance in Kazakhstan, year by year

Annual values for Coverage in extreme poor (<$2.15 a day) (%) - All Social Assistance in Kazakhstan, 2007 to 2021.
Year Value Change
2007 53.4%
2010 66.8% +25.1%
2014 32.0% -52.1%
2015 81.4% +154.0%
2017 64.1% -21.2%
2018 30.4% -52.6%
2019 47.4% +55.8%
2020 48.4% +2.2%
2021 4.0% -91.7%
